What is a Feather Down Farm?
A large canvas lodge with wooden floors, proper beds and a wood-burning cooking stove — comfy but delightfully off-grid.

Feather Down Farms in Scotland
It’s glamping in a spacious canvas lodge on a real working Scottish farm.
They’re largely off-grid — a wood-burning stove provides cooking and warmth, and there’s no Wi-Fi.
Yes — ideal for families, with farm animals to meet and space to explore.
Bedding may be provided or hired, and there’s often an honesty shop. Check each site.
